Mutant Snare & Mutant Hihats added to the Mad Music Machine


"We added the Mutant Snare and Mutant Hihats to the Mad Music Machine today - but soon realised we didn't have enough patch cables to connect everything up the way we wanted!

So we modified our existing Sonic Pi drum machine code to work with external MIDI and ran the drum modules through the System-1m to the Trigger Out.

We then set up a simple System-1m patch to use the 4 MIDI notes as they passed through to the drum modules"
